    CARBON MONOXIDE REMOVER

    Abstract: PROBLEM TO BE SOLVED: To provide a compact carbon monoxide remover. SOLUTION: The carbon monoxide remover 10 is constituted by joining two substrates 13, 14. The joining surface of these substrates 13, 14 is formed with a winding microchannel 15, and the bottom of the microchannel 15 is supported with a catalyst 12. An introduction port 16 of the microchannel 15 is supplied with a gaseous mixture containing carbon monoxide gas, carbon dioxide gas, hydrogen gas, air, or the like. The gaseous mixture flows through the microchannel 15 to discharge from a discharge port 17. The carbon monoxide gas in the gaseous mixture is selectively oxidized by the catalyst 12. The microchannel 15 is designed to satisfy an inequality of 0.25≤d cha 2 V /L cha D m ≤2, wherein the mean flow rate of the gaseous mixture is v, the length of the microchannel 15 is d cha , and the effective diffusion coefficient of the carbon monoxide gas in the microchannel 15 is D m .
